About Pope Valley
Pope Valley, California, operates under a city government structure known as the Pope Valley Community Services District (CSD). Board members serve four-year terms, with elections held in November of even-numbered years. Regular meetings of the Pope Valley Community Services District Board are held on the second Tuesday of each month at 6:00 PM.
Law enforcement in Pope Valley falls under the jurisdiction of the Napa County Sheriff’s Office. Arrest records and criminal records are carefully kept and can be accessed through the Sheriff's Office's dedicated records division. The Napa County Jail, located in Napa, is the detention facility for people arrested in Pope Valley. The area is known for its low crime rates, which can be attributed to the strong community ties and active involvement in local safety initiatives. Residents of Pope Valley can request public records under the California Public Records Act (CPRA), helping with access to a variety of documents. For vital records such as birth, death, and marriage certificates, individuals should contact the Napa County Clerk-Recorder's Office, which provides services to obtain these important documents. Property records can be accessed through the Napa County Assessor's Office, while court records are available via the Napa County Superior Court. Many of these services offer online portals, making it easier for residents to request and obtain records without the need for in-person visits, thus streamlining the process for accessing essential information.
